About the role
THE ROLE
The Senior Evidence and Insights Adviser provides strategic leadership for evaluation, research and policy development across the Aboriginal Initiatives Unit. The role supports the implementation, monitoring and future direction of Dhelk Dja: Safe Our Way and related Aboriginal family violence reforms.
The role leads the design, commissioning and oversight of culturally safe, Aboriginal-led and evidence-informed evaluations, reviews and research. It develops evaluation and learning frameworks, assesses qualitative and quantitative evidence, and translates findings, community priorities and practice knowledge into clear policy advice and practical recommendations.
Working in partnership with Dhelk Dja governance structures, Aboriginal communities and organisations, departmental teams, other government agencies, research bodies and service providers, the role ensures evaluation and research approaches uphold Aboriginal self-determination, Aboriginal data sovereignty, cultural safety and ethical practice.
The role operates with a high degree of autonomy, manages complex and sensitive projects, provides advice and influences senior stakeholders to improve policy, program and system outcomes for Aboriginal people, families and communities.
